COVID Zoom Trial – Injured Cruise Passenger Awarded $1.35 Million
By Kelsey Monaghan At the first Federal Court Zoom trial in history a Holland America cruise ship passenger was awarded $1.35 million after being hit by an opening door in the hallway of the ship.
